Bernd Brodesser schrieb:
Hallo Liste,
ich mache ein paar Gehversuche mit perl. Gibt es eine Möglichkeit aus einer Liste ein Teil herauszunehmen, ohne daß die Liste in einer Variablen abgespeichert ist?
Als Beispiel, wenn ich den Wochentag haben möchte, so geht das wie folt:
@zeit = localtime(time); print @zeit[6], "\n";
Es geht aber nicht
print localtime(time) [6], "\n";
Du kannst es so machen: print ( (localtime(time)) [6], "\n" ) ; ......^.............................^ Diese Klammern braucht es. Absolut empfehlenswert ist "Programmieren mit Perl", OŽReilly. (Wenn du es nicht schon hast). Da stehen gute Beispiele drin, wie z.B.: $heute = (Mo, Di, Mi, Do, Fr, Sa, So) [(localtime)[6]]; $heute enthält dann direkt die Abkürzung des Wochentages. Genial. Perl lohnt sich auf jeden Fall zu lernen. -- Grüße, Bert --------------------------------------------------------------------- To unsubscribe, e-mail: suse-linux-unsubscribe@suse.com For additional commands, e-mail: suse-linux-help@suse.com